Road accidents claim four lives

OUR STAFF REPORTER BAHAWALNAGAR - Road accidents claimed four lives and left seven injured here on Friday. The first accident took place in Muhala Farooqabad where a youth namely Tanveer,21, was trampled by a speeding bus when he was standing on the bank of the road. As a result, he died on the spot. His parents declared the death of their son as accident. In the second accident, on the Chishtian Road, two motorbikes collided against each other. In the collision, Fatima, Sabira ,Yasin, Meer Baksh, Sultan and Allah Ditta sustained serious injuries. Rescue 1122 team rushed to the spot and shifted the injured to DHQ Hospital, Bahawalnagar. The third accident claimed life of One Shafique of Minchinabad. His motorcycle had rammed into a cart. In the accident, Ayesha sustained injuries. However, on the Bahawalnagar-Fortabbas Road, two person - Nadeem and Amin - badly hit by a motorbike and lost their lives. They belonged to nearby village.
